  • Publication number: 20060175099
    Abstract: The object of this invention is to provide a mobile robot base with a decoupled turret mechanism, including a turret (80), a turret motor (1) provided on the turret (80), an actuating motor unit provided on the turret (80) to actuate a plurality of wheels (90), an actuating gear train unit to transmit an actuating force generated from train (10) coupled between the turret (80) and the turret motor (1), and a differential gear train unit coupled to both the turret gear train and the actuating motor unit, so that the differential gear train unit subtracts the rotation of the turret (80) from the rotation of the actuating motor unit, thus transmitting a subtracted rotation to the plurality of wheels (90), and thus, only the rotation of the actuating motor unit is transmitted to the plurality of wheels (90).

  • Patent number: 6470290
    Abstract: The present invention supports power management modes which includes (1) a maximum power performance mode, (2) a battery-optimized mode, and (3) a performance/optimization cycling mode for performing the maximum performance mode and the battery-optimized mode alternately within a prescribed period of time. The cycling mode allows flexibility in power management and faster charging of the battery.
